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
将 IFORT 与 nvcc 和 CUSP 结合使用的未解决的引用
我有一个正在编译的程序 如下所示 Some ifort f c nvcc c src bicgstab cu o bicgstab o I home ricardo apps cusp cusplibrary Some more for c
c
CUDA
Fortran
intelfortran
cusplibrary
函数数组和分段错误 - 无效的内存引用
我正在尝试设置我的功能f作为数组 但我收到以下错误 Program received signal SIGSEGV Segmentation fault invalid memory reference Backtrace for this
Arrays
function
Fortran
dimension
geany
C 中的暂定定义和链接
考虑由两个文件组成的 C 程序 f1 c int x f2 c int x 2 我对第6 9 2段的阅读C99标准 http www open std org JTC1 SC22 wg14 www docs n1124 pdf是这个计划应该
c
Compilation
Fortran
staticanalysis
C99
如何在大小写敏感模式下在 gfortran 中编译?
是否可以编译 fortran 90 95 代码gfortran with 区分大小写 我搜索了手册 但找不到任何可以给 gfortran 的标志或选项以使其区分大小写 我希望大写和小写的变量不同 那么 有可能吗 没有这样的标志或选项 当然
Fortran
gfortran
是否存在与 Fortran 配合良好的 ncurses 或类似库? [关闭]
Closed 这个问题正在寻求书籍 工具 软件库等的推荐 不满足堆栈溢出指南 help closed questions 目前不接受答案 ncurses 库 最初是用 C 语言开发的 如果没记错的话 是否有一个端口 或者是否存在可以在 Wi
Fortran
ncurses
如何在 Fortran 中将子例程名称作为参数传递?
将子例程名称作为参数传递的语法是什么 示意图 call action mySubX argA argB subroutine action whichSub argA argB call subroutine whichSub argA a
Fortran
subroutine
MPI中如何获取物理机的数量
我可以用MPI Comm size获取处理器总数 但是如何获取真实物理机的数量呢 If by 物理机你的意思是一组处理元素 共享公共内存地址空间 然后是 MPI 3 按类型分割操作MPI COMM SPLIT TYPE可用于便携式获取此类机
c
Fortran
MPI
Fortran - 逻辑索引
假设我有一个矩阵A这是 m x n 和一个向量B这是 m x 1 这个向量B是一个由 0 和 1 组成的向量 还让标量s是其中元素的总和B 我想创建一个矩阵C这是s x n对应于行B等于 1 并且是一个向量D即 s x 1 这些元素的位置在
Indexing
Fortran
logicaloperators
当虚拟对象具有指定长度时传递字符串作为参数
如果我有这个代码 module test contains subroutine xx name character len 20 intent in optional name if present name then print nam
string
Fortran
fortran90
Fortran 多态性、函数和分配
我是 Fortran OOP 的初学者 我正在尝试编写一个程序 其中包含处理多态变量作为参数的过程 尽管我的原始代码要复杂得多 许多过程 几个派生类型等 但我可以隔离我的问题的一个简单示例 例如 我有一个复制多态变量并稍微修改此副本的过程
function
memoryleaks
polymorphism
Fortran
fortran2003
Fortran:哪种方法可以更快地更改数组的等级? (重塑与指针)
当我们处理大型数组时 考虑数组的等级和形状变化的成本可能很重要 特别是当它在多个子例程 函数中发生几次时 我问题的主要目的是将数组的排名从第二更改为第一 反之亦然 为此 可以使用 重塑声明 指针变量 下面的代码展示了如何使用指针变量 pro
Arrays
pointers
Fortran
reshape
FORTRAN 95:是否可以在不共享源代码的情况下共享模块?
我希望能够共享 FORTRAN 95 模块而不共享其源代码 是否可以这样做 也许通过共享 MOD 文件 如果这是相关的 我在 Plato 上使用 Silverfrost FTN95 编译器 到目前为止 我只能通过使用外部模块的源代码来完成这
module
Fortran
fortran95
Fortran 中的断言
Fortran 是否有与 C 等效的标准函数 关键字assert 我找不到assert我在 Fortran 2003 标准中提到过 我发现了几种使用预处理器的方法 但是在这个answer https stackoverflow com a
Fortran
preprocessor
assert
自由格式代码可以包含在固定格式代码中吗?
我继承了一个固定格式文件 FFTRUN f 该文件的开头如下所示 SUBROUTINE FFTRUN 2e USE intrinsic ISO C BINDING USE FFTWmod ONLY FFTWplan fwd FFTWplan
Fortran
gfortran
gdb 中漂亮的打印 Fortran 动态类型
在 gdb 中打印 Fortran 可分配多态变量的值是非常痛苦的 给出下面的程序 为了看到alloc ext 我必须执行以下操作 gdb p alloc ext 1 data 0x606260 vptr 0x400ce0 lt foo M
Fortran
GDB
MinGW:与 LAPACK 和 BLAS 链接会导致 C++ 异常无法处理
情况很简单 但却很奇怪 当我在没有 LinearAlgebra o 源代码 需要链接到 LAPACK 的情况下编译程序时 会捕获并处理 C 异常 当我不包含该编译单元但仍然链接到库时 llapack lblas 捕获并处理异常 但是一旦我把
c
Exception
MinGW
Fortran
Lapack
使用 mkl,加载共享库时出错:libmkl_intel_lp64.so
我几乎是新使用的mkl图书馆 如果这看起来很愚蠢 请原谅 我尝试运行教程中的示例 here https software intel com en us node 529744 with ifort mkl dgemm example f
matrix
Fortran
intelmkl
使用 c_f_pointer 是否就地重塑 fortran 数组
我有一个与几年前提出的问题相关的问题英特尔开发者论坛 https software intel com en us forums intel fortran compiler for linux and mac os x topic 269
Fortran
reshape
inplace
fortranisocbinding
执行程序时的Fortran77参数
我目前正在做 Fortran77 作业 所以请不要告诉我确切的编码 但请给我一些我想要做什么的提示 使用UNIX终端 我想通过执行来获取传递的参数 program exe parameter 在标准 Fortran77 中你不能 故事结局
Fortran
Fortran77
将数组广播为不同的形状(添加“假”维度)
在 python 中 使用 numpy 我可以将数组广播为不同的形状 gt gt gt import numpy as np gt gt gt a np array 2 3 4 gt gt gt b np zeros 3 2 gt gt g
python
Arrays
NumPy
Fortran
arraybroadcasting
«
1 ...
3
4
5
6
7
8
9
...27
»